© Copyright 2012 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ice.
HP NonStop Database Solution Marco Sansoni, HP NonStop Business Critical Systems
9 ottobre 2012
CHOICE - CONFIDENCE - CONSISTENCY
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Agenda
• Introduction to HP NonStop platform
• HP NonStop SQL database solution
• Conclusion
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
NonStop by the numbers
375M+ Supporting over 375M subscribers
in advanced Telco network
applications
Source: Infonetics Service Providers Report, 2011
and TRAI Report, 2012
10B+ Processing 68 million credit
card accounts and over 10
billion transactions annually
Source: HP internal sales data, 2012
38 Years of service
and success (1974)
Source: HP internal sales data, 2012
Availability level 4 for fully
fault-tolerant servers
100% uptime
Source: IDC Worldwide and U.S. High-Availability
Server, 2011-2015 Forecast and Analysis
© Copyright 2012 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ice. 4
Communications, Media,
and Entertainment
Supporting over 375M subscribers in
advanced Telco network applications
Financial Services
Processing 68 million credit card accounts
and over 10 billion transactions annually
Source: Infonetics Service Providers Report, 2011 and TRAI Report, 2012
Source: HP internal sales data, 2012
Business demands change, but the value of
NonStop is timeless.
Manufacturing
and Distribution
Powering mission-critical applications at
100% of the top 10 global manufacturers Source: HP internal sales data, 2012
Public Sector
and Healthcare
Supporting one of the world’s
top medical institutions Source: HP internal sales data, 2012
© Copyright 2012 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ice. 5
Largest NonStop customers in the world
Mercedes-Benz
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Customers realize availability benefits of NS SQL
NonStop SQL handles critical business needs
A securities company moves to NonStop SQL for its superior
performance and availability
Cost of downtime $3M/hour
Objective is to manage the transactions with no unplanned
downtime
Performing at 2000 tps, driving 20,000 sql statements from 10,000
concurrent users over 2000 JDBC connections
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Customers realize scalability and availability benefits of NonStop
SQL
7
An internet service provider uses NonStop SQL to manage Petabytes of
database
Drives more than 100’000 tps
no outage since going live in 1995
managed by 2 DBA
NonStop SQL handles critical business needs
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Customers realize mixed workload benefits of NonStop SQL
8
An intelligence agency manages 150++TB of NonStop SQL database
Drives mixed-workload consisting of 39,000 ingests/second
concurrently with >5000 ad-hoc and OLAP queries, and database
maintenance activities concurrently
Mixed workload capabilities are available out-of-the-box
No need of application partitioning and multi-tier complex architectures
to workaround lack of these capabilities
NonStop SQL handles critical business needs
© Copyright 2012 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ice. 9
World’s highest application availability
Lower Total Cost of Ownership
Simple & integrated ‘out of the box’
The NonStop approach
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
HP NonStop SQL DB solution
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Performance • Need better response times
• Continuous data availability requirements
Scalability • More data, More Users
Capability • Real-time, mining
Cost and complexity • ‘Out-of-the-box’ efficiencies, consolidate
workloads, reduce costs, manageability
11
Market Requirements Affect Database Choices
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
12
Massive parallelism (MPP shared nothing architecture)
Out of the box clustered database (4096 multi-core cpu )
Linear scalability (98,5%)
Fault tolerance (Process Pairs technology)
Disaster recovery and automated operations
Online repair, upgrades and reconfiguration (--> 100% uptime )
Standard Interfaces (JDBC-ODBC)
HP NonStop SQL Overview
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Provide information in real-time : data accessed anytime anywhere
NonStop SQL handles critical business needs
13
NonStop SQL has industry’s most elegant mixed workload handling
NonStop SQL engine executes concurrent database updates, queries and batch operations
No need for application partitioning
Customers enjoy flexible configurations
Customers can start small with a 2-core database server and scale to thousands of cores
Customers scale user data from 146 GB to Petabytes
There are no constraints on how to scale the server in response to growth in business
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
14
NonStop SQL delivers out-of-the-box cluster awareness and management
No add-on cluster software download and configuration
Adding resources to a cluster is done online in simple steps, complexity taken away
It takes only 19 steps from receving media to having a NonStop SQL database instance up and
running
NonStop SQL handles critical business needs Customers enjoy clustering and lack of complexity benefits
Low TCO means saving money with NonStop SQL
All DBA productivity tools are included with the base SQL license with no additional costs
No additional Partitioning Software licenses required
Diagnostic, Tuning, Management packs are all included in the base license
NonStop has fewer moving parts and less complexity, leading to lower operational costs
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Conclusions
The real database OLTP machine
The HP NonStop database solution
All modern Out-of-the-box cluster aware
Virtualized data
Parallel query execution
Online manageability
All standard ANSI compliant
JDBC
ODBC
All NonStop 24/7 database availability
Linear scalability
Mixed workload handling
Real Time
Start small and scale on-line with flexible scale-out/up options
© Copyright 2012 Hewlett-Packard Development Company, L.P.
The information contained herein is subject to change without notice.
Thank you [email protected]
Life cycle of a database migration
Planning and process
Phases Main activities
Assess IT architectural assessment – understand current state
Investigate scope, duration + cost of project
Identify business dependencies
Identify technical dependencies
Plan Identify people, resources and required skills
Identify tools for the migration
Identify HW + SW resources for the migration
Create overall project plan
Conversion +
implementation
Automatic conversion of DDL , scripts ,database objects, queries => user acceptance
Extract, cleanse and migrate data => parallel run
Unit tests, performance tests, integration tests => go live
Assess Plan Conversion Implementation
© Copyright 2012 Hewlett-Packard Development Company, L.P. The information contained herein is subject to change without notice. 20
Mission-critical computing defined
Highest level of availability
Availability
Level IDC Definition
AL 4 • Transparent to user
• No interruption of work
• No transactions lost
• No degradation in performance
AL 3 • Stays online
• Current transaction may need restarting
• May experience performance degradation
AL 2 • User interrupted, but can quickly re-log on
• May need to rerun some transactions from journal file
• May experience performance degradation
AL 1 • Work stops
• Uncontrolled shutdown
“AL4 defines fully fault-tolerant
servers, in which redundancy of
components, combined with special
software, ensures that processing will
continue, even if there is a failure in a
single hardware component in one area
of the system.”
Source: IDC Worldwide and U.S. High-Availability Server, 2011-2015 Forecast and Analysis
HP Integrity NonStop
Servers
“The market has inflated the term
‘mission critical’. At the highest level, it
means more than a major
inconvenience. It can mean business
failure.”